Though London Waterloo East is a bustling hub, it provides essential amenities to ensure a smooth experience for travelers. While it lacks a traditional ticket office, fear not—ticket machines are readily available for both purchase and collection of pre-booked tickets. Accessibility is thoughtfully catered for, with accessible ticket machines and step-free access via lifts from Waterloo Main station. Need assistance? Help points are clearly marked, and staff are on hand to lend a helping hand when needed.
For those traveling with youngsters or seeking some comfort, the station hosts heated waiting rooms and accessible toilets with baby-changing facilities. CCTV surveillance is in place to ensure a secure environment throughout your journey. Hungry or in need of caffeine fix? Grab a snack or a hot drink from the coffee shops and vending machines on site—no worries about missing the news as newspapers are available too!

Despite its small size, Lenham Train Station offers a range of facilities. Travelers will find a ticket office open from 06:20 to 13:00, Monday to Saturday, with ticket machines available for purchases outside office hours. If you've bought your tickets online, collection is straightforward at the station's ticket machines, conveniently located by the entrance to platform 2.
For those needing assistance, help is available during the ticket office hours. The station is equipped with customer help points and displays up-to-date travel information through announcement systems and departure screens. While Lenham Station may not have the most comprehensive amenities, like wa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, the essentials ensure a smooth travel experience. A small seating area and accessible ramps further accommodate passengers.
